Mask R-CNN: 一种强大的目标检测模型

2023-12-13 0 594

本文目录导读:

  1. Mask R-CNN概述
  2. Mask R-CNN的优点
  3. Mask R-CNN的缺点
  4. Mask R-CNN的应用

随着深度学习和计算机视觉技术的不断发展,目标检测已成为图像处理和计算机视觉领域的热门话题,目标检测的目的是在图像中识别和定位特定的对象,在过去的几年里,许多优秀的目标检测模型被提出,其中Mask R-CNN模型因其优秀的性能和广泛的应用而备受关注,本文将介绍Mask R-CNN模型,并探讨其优缺点以及在目标检测领域的应用。

Mask R-CNN概述

Mask R-CNN是在R-CNN系列模型的基础上引入分割任务的端到端目标检测模型,与R-CNN系列模型相比,Mask R-CNN在RPN(Region Proposal Network)阶段增加了分割任务,使其能够更好地捕捉图像中的细节信息,Mask R-CNN还采用了RoI Align方法来避免因RoI Pooling引起的位置偏移问题,这些改进使得Mask R-CNN在目标检测和分割任务中表现出色。

Mask R-CNN的优点

1、端到端训练:Mask R-CNN模型可以在一个框架下同时完成目标检测和分割任务,无需进行后处理,这使得Mask R-CNN在训练和测试过程中更加高效。

2、更好的特征捕捉:由于Mask R-CNN在RPN阶段引入了分割任务,它可以更好地捕捉图像中的细节信息,从而提高目标检测的准确性。

3、避免位置偏移问题:Mask R-CNN采用了RoI Align方法,避免了因RoI Pooling引起的位置偏移问题,进一步提高了目标检测的精度。

4、强大的性能:Mask R-CNN在许多标准数据集上表现出色,例如COCO、VOC等,其性能超过了其他许多目标检测模型。

Mask R-CNN的缺点

1、计算量大:由于Mask R-CNN需要同时完成两个任务(目标检测和分割),其计算量相对较大,训练和测试时间较长。

2、对硬件要求高:由于Mask R-CNN需要处理大量的图像数据,对硬件设备(例如GPU)的要求较高,这增加了使用成本。

3、可能过拟合:由于Mask R-CNN需要同时处理多个任务,可能会出现过拟合的问题,这可能会影响其在某些特定任务上的表现。

Mask R-CNN的应用

Mask R-CNN因其强大的性能和广泛的应用而备受关注,它在许多领域都有应用,例如人脸识别、物体识别、场景分割等,在人脸识别领域,Mask R-CNN可以用于人脸检测和人脸分割任务,从而提高了人脸识别的准确性和鲁棒性,在物体识别领域,Mask R-CNN可以用于目标检测和分割任务,从而提高了物体识别的精度和速度,在场景分割领域,Mask R-CNN可以用于分割图像中的各个对象,从而为后续的图像处理和分析提供了便利。

Mask R-CNN是一种强大的目标检测模型,它通过引入分割任务和采用RoI Align方法提高了目标检测的准确性和鲁棒性,它也存在一些缺点,例如计算量大、对硬件要求高等,未来,我们可以继续探索如何优化Mask R-CNN模型,以提高其性能和降低其计算成本,我们也可以探索如何将Mask R-CNN与其他技术相结合,以进一步扩展其在各个领域的应用范围。

相关文章

猜你喜欢
官方客服团队

为您解决烦忧 - 24小时在线 专业服务

  • 0 +

    访问总数

  • 0 +

    会员总数

  • 0 +

    文章总数

  • 0 +

    今日发布

  • 0 +

    本周发布

  • 4975 +

    运行天数

你的前景,远超我们想象